Yogi endured years of neglect after his owner’s death, spending three years chained and nearly blind. “His rusty collar served as a cruel reminder of isolation and abandonment.” When rescued, he weighed only 12.3 pounds, suffering from torn skin, parasites, and severe weakness. “Despite the pain and despair, Yogi showed incredible resilience.” With medical care and support, he regained 30% of his vision and began healing emotionally. Bea, his companion, played a vital role in his recovery, offering comfort and helping Yogi “explore the world with curiosity and newfound confidence.”
